SimX was awarded an R&D contract with the U.S. Air Force to create high-quality, multiplayer digital actuality medical coaching simulations. The simulations will leverage new Qualcomm Snapdragon XR2 capabilities on the HTC Vive Focus 3 headset.
SAN FRANCISCO, Nov. 8, 2022 /PRNewswire/ — SimX, Inc. has been awarded an R&D contract by the U.S. Air Force to develop enhanced VR medical simulation coaching capabilities for battlefield tactical fight casualty care (TCCC), with a give attention to enhanced flexibility and repeatability of coaching.
The program will give attention to adapting present SimX Virtual Reality Medical Simulation System (VRMSS) with enhanced capabilities that may considerably improve the utility throughout DOD medical coaching.
Project enhancements will leverage the variation of the VRMSS for the brand new Qualcomm Snapdragon XR2 chipset utilizing the HTC Vive Focus 3 headset platform, which can allow considerably enhanced graphical realism whereas sustaining portability, wi-fi operation, and seamless co-located multiplayer simulation.
“The vision of the VALOR program is to adapt VR medical simulation training to enable high-quality, repeatable, and accessible clinical training for any scenario,” mentioned Karthik V Sarma, PhD, VALOR Principal Investigator and SimX CTO. “We’re excited to work with the USAF and HTC to develop the next generation of medical simulation training.”
The program’s objectives embody enhancing medical realism, supporting customizable capabilities at runtime based mostly on the learner inhabitants, dynamically configuring environments to improve the spectrum of psychosocial realism (i.e., climate results, day/evening operations, evening imaginative and prescient functionality), and on-the-fly state of affairs tailoring to meet academic goals. The developed capabilities may also be made accessible for business use to help civilian medical simulation coaching throughout the spectrum of well being professionals, with enhancements delivered to tons of of SimX’s present prospects together with nursing colleges, doctor coaching applications, EMS suppliers, and lots of extra.

SimX created an industry-leading digital actuality medical simulation platform https://www.simxvr.com/ that’s used world wide and by prime establishments together with Mayo Clinic, Stanford, Northwestern, University of Pennsylvania, the US Air Force, and lots of others. It permits trainees to work collectively in multiplayer digital actuality circumstances both collectively in the identical area or from the protection of their very own properties. SimX developed a novel system that permits for a “holodeck-like” expertise with out dropdown menus or digital choices. You discuss and work together with digital sufferers the identical method that you’d in actual life. The scalable SimX Scenario System permits for fast improvement of latest coaching supplies and circumstances, and prompt deployment to all learners.
